1,008,819 is a composite number, odd.
1,008,819 (one million eight thousand eight hundred nineteen) is an odd 7-digit number. It is a composite number with 24 divisors, and factors as 3² × 7 × 67 × 239. Written other ways, in hexadecimal, 0xF64B3.
